My order: This long-established Springfield restaurant is a fixture downtown. Despite its old-world charm décor with wood, etched glass panels, and white tablecloths, the lunchtime atmosphere is casual. Outdoor dining is an option. I ordered a daily special -- chicken salad on tomato which came with house-made chips ($13.52). My companion chose the special soup of the day, a melon soup consisting of two different melons and watermelon ($5.98), and a bacon, lettuce, and tomato sandwich ($12.48).

Likes: The chef sources much of the food locally. The bright, juicy tomatoes were from the Old Capitol Farmers Market. The herbs in the chicken salad were from the restaurant’s rooftop garden where honeybees also reside. As a gardener and someone who loves to cook, it’s delightful to dine on fresh, organic food. My companion enjoyed the generous tomato slice in his sandwich and the savory, melon essence of the soup.

Dislikes: None

What would I order next time? In season, hands down I would order the chicken salad on tomato again. Otherwise, I would try the Monte Cristo sandwich with slices of turkey, ham, and Swiss on white bread dipped in egg and cooked golden brown served with mild jalapeno jelly ($15.96).
